Indian space startup GalaxEye secured a US patent for its satellite sensor synchronisation system. This technology allows for precise, simultaneous imaging of Earth, even through clouds. The patent strengthens GalaxEye's position in the growing Earth imaging data market. The company plans to launch a thirty-satellite constellation within five years. This development supports India's ambitious commercial space industry growth goals.
